BACKGROUND: Circulating monocytes are classified into three subsets according to their CD14 and CD16 expressions. Here we investigated all three subsets in patients with squamous cell carcinoma of the head and neck (SCCHN). METHODS: Peripheral blood from 54 patients with SCCHN and 24 healthy donors (HDs) was tested for flowcytometry. Immunohistochemical staining of the primary tumor was performed. SCCHN cells were co-cultured with human monocytes in vitro. RESULTS: The level of intermediate monocytes was significantly lower in SCCHN than in HDs. The expression levels of HLA-G, PD-L1, and CD51 on intermediate monocytes was evidently greater in patients with SCCHN. In vitro co-culturing of SCCHN cells with monocytes revealed a significant increase in CD51 expression levels on monocytes. The decrease in expression levels of the maturation markers CX3CR1 and CD68 was significantly correlated to poor clinical outcomes. CONCLUSION: The level of intermediate monocytes was decreased in cancer patients in favor of immature and expressed immunosuppressive molecules.

Milk fat globule-epidermal growth factor 8 (MFG-E8) is a glycoprotein secreted by the activated macrophages and acts as a bridge between apoptotic cells and phagocytes. Aside from macrophages, a variety of malignant cells also express MFG-E8. The objective of this study is to elucidate the clinical relevance and significance of MFG-E8 in the tumor microenvironment (TME) of patients with oral squamous cell carcinoma (OSCC). We investigated MFG-E8 expression in 74 patients with OSCC by immunohistochemistry and evaluated the relationship between MFG-E8 expression and various clinicopathological factors including immune cell infiltration. MFG-E8 expression was detected in 34 of 74 (45.9%) patients with OSCC and a significant correlation was observed with levels of infiltrating T cells, macrophages, and immunosuppressive M2 macrophages. Furthermore, MFG-E8 expression was also associated with clinical stage, lymphatic/vascular invasion, and Ki-67+ tumor cells but not with survival. Our results suggest that MFG-E8 may play an important role in shaping the immune suppressive network in TME as well as tumor progression.
